The Mystery of Edwin Drood Illustrated

Charles Dickens
The Mystery of Edwin Drood is the final novel by Charles Dickens. originally published in 1870.Though the novel is named after the character Edwin Drood, it focuses more on Drood's uncle, John Jasper, a precentor, choirmaster and opium addict, who is in love with his pupil, Rosa Bud. The mystery of edwin drood was scheduled to be published in twelve instalments (shorter than dickens's usual twenty) from april 1870 to february 1871, each costing one shilling and illustrated by luke fildes. In april 1870, there appeared the first instalment of dickens's new novel, the mystery of edwin drood, set mainly in rochester (‘cloisterham’) and planned for publication in eleven monthly instalments, the last one to be a double number.
